For those who are new to this teen ministry blog-site, “The Rebelution” is defined as “a teenage rebellion against the low expectations of an ungodly culture.” It’s motto is “Do Hard Things.” Is this another example of teenagers trying to change the world? Well, yes. But this time there is a lot more maturity behind it.

Young adults in every generation tend to swerve into one ditch or the other—lawlessness and rebellion on the left and legalism and self-righteousness on the right. If you try too hard to avoid the one you are likely to swerve into the other. The road itself is the Lordship of Jesus Christ. It is only maintained by walking in the power of the Holy Spirit in the light of God’s Word, the Bible and showing your love for God by the way you love others, and especially those He has placed in your life—as family, church, friends and neighbors.
